BlockBeats message, April 1, according to Hyperinsight monitoring, overnight U.S. stocks in the storage chip sector surged broadly. SanDisk (SNDK) jumped more than 10%, and Micron Technology (MU) rose more than 7%.

Before the market rebound, on Hyperliquid, a giant whale starting with 0xa65 had already made early moves yesterday afternoon, opening a 3x leveraged MU long position. The entry average price was $322, the position size was $8.74 million, and upon opening the position it became the largest MU long on-chain. As the sector surged strongly today, the unrealized profit on this position has reached $504,000 (+15%).
